Correspondences of Litha

The plants & herbs associated with Litha are: Anise, mugwort, chamomile, rose, wild rose, oak blossoms, lily, cinquefoil, lavender, fennel, elder, mistletoe, hemp, carnation, thyme, honeysuckle, ivy, larkspur, nettle, wisteria, Vervain ( verbena), St. John’s wort, hearts ease  rue, fern, wormwood, pine, heather, yarrow, oak & holly trees,daisy,frankincense, lemon, sandalwood, heliotrope, copal, saffron, galangal, laurel and ylang-ylang

Colors associated with Litha :White, Red, Gold, Green, Blue and Tan
Stones associated with Litha: include all green gemstones, especially emerald and jade. Other appropriate gemstones are tiger’s eye, lapis lazuli , diamonds, agate, alexandrite, fluorite, moonstone, and pearl
Incense and oils you can use any of the following scents, either blended together or alone: Heliotrope, saffron, orange, frankincense & myrrh, wisteria, cinnamon, mint, rose, lemon, lavender, sandalwood, pine.
Animals associated with Litha are:  all Summer birds.Wren, robin, peacock, frog, butterfly, horses, cattle
Mythical Being and mythical beasts associated with Litha are: satyrs, faeries, firebirds, dragons, thunderbirds and manticores.

Gods and Goddess Associated with Litha: Father Gods and Mother Goddesses, Pregnant Goddesses and Sun Deities. Particular emphasis might be placed on the Goddesses Aphrodite, Astarte, Freya, Hathor, Ishtar, Venus and other Goddesses who preside over love, passion and beauty. Other Litha deities include Athena, Artemis, Dana, Kali, Isis, Juno, Apollo, Dagda, Gwydion, Helios, Llew, Oak/Holly King, Lugh, Ra, Sol, Zeus, Prometheus, Ares, and Thor.

Symbols for Litha:The sun, oak, birch & fir branches, sun flowers, lilies, red/maize/yellow or gold flower, love amulets, seashells, summer fruits & flowers, feather/flower door wreath, sun wheel, fire, circles of stone, sun dials and swords/blades, bird feathers, Witches’ ladder

Foods of Litha-fresh vegetables of all kinds and fresh fruits such as lemons and oranges, summer fruits, honey, Summer squash and any yellow or orange colored foods. Traditional drinks are ale, mead, and fresh fruit juice.

Activities~~Picnics, leave out food for faeries, jumping bonfires, gathering herbs.

Spell work~~Healing, love magick, protection, purification, energy, faery
